What is a Flush Door?

A flush door is characterized by its flat surface, which does not have any protruding frames or panels. This minimalist design makes it an ideal choice for both contemporary and traditional interiors. Flush doors are typically made from solid wood, hollow core, or composite materials, offering a range of options to fit varying budgets and aesthetics.

Choosing the Right Flush Door Style

When selecting a flush door, it’s essential to consider the door style that aligns with your home’s aesthetic. Here’s a breakdown of popular flush door styles:

  • Solid Core Flush Doors: These doors are made from a solid material, providing durability and better sound insulation. They’re perfect for bedrooms or bathrooms where privacy is paramount.
  • Hollow Core Flush Doors: Lighter and more affordable, hollow core doors are suitable for interior spaces that don’t require extensive soundproofing.
  • Textured Flush Doors: For a unique touch, textured flush doors can add depth and visual interest, mimicking the look of wood grain or other materials.
  • Custom Flush Doors: If standard options don’t fit your vision, custom doors can be designed to match your specific requirements, providing a personalized touch to your home.

Maintenance and Care for Flush Doors

Maintaining flush doors is relatively simple, but a few best practices can ensure their longevity:

  • Regular Cleaning: Wipe down the surfaces with a damp cloth to remove dust and grime. Avoid harsh chemicals that may damage the finish.
  • Inspect for Damage: Periodically check for scratches or dents, especially if you have pets or children. Minor damage can often be repaired with wood filler or paint.
  • Proper Installation: Ensuring that your flush door is properly installed will prevent issues like sticking or misalignment, which can lead to more significant problems down the line.

FAQs About Flush Doors

1. What materials are flush doors made from?

Flush doors can be made from solid wood, hollow core materials, or composite materials. The choice depends on your budget and desired aesthetic.

2. Are flush doors energy-efficient?

Yes, solid core flush doors offer excellent insulation properties, which can help maintain the temperature of your home and reduce energy costs.

3. Can flush doors be painted?

Absolutely! Flush doors can be easily painted in any color to match your interior design preferences.

4. How do I choose the right size flush door?

Measure your door frame accurately and consult standard sizes to find a flush door that fits. Custom options are also available if standard sizes don’t work.

5. Do flush doors provide good sound insulation?

Yes, solid core flush doors are particularly effective at reducing sound transmission, making them ideal for bedrooms and home offices.

6. What are the best hardware options for flush doors?

Consider using modern, minimalistic handles and hinges to maintain the sleek look of flush doors. Stainless steel or matte black finishes are popular choices.
